About this role

Job Description:

ITW Deltar Fasteners is a large division within the Automotive Segment and serves all the major OEMs and their tier suppliers with plastic fasteners. Locations include Frankfort, IL, Chippewa Falls, WI, and our Commercial Sales and Engineering in Troy, MI. 

The division drives profitability by leveraging its innovative solutions and application engineering.  In addition to ITW’s industry leading research and development capabilities, ITW Deltar Fasteners enhances our customers’ competitive advantage by:

  • Maintaining advanced engineering and manufacturing facilities in NA.
  • Exchanging product, process, and benchmarking information with sister units worldwide.
  • Continually improving processes, material, and designs to ensure every product exceeds customer specifications while providing unparalleled value.

Position Summary:

The Production Supervisor reports to the Manufacturing Manager.  The major areas of responsibility for this position are supervising manufacturing employees to ensure a well-executed shift while working alongside employees and provide Technical Support to your respective Manufacturing departments/cell(s).

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Direct staff for work assignments based upon priority
  • Lead by creating an engaged and positive environment on the Shift
  • Ensure Shift personnel are executing their job responsibilities
  • Hold employees accountable to the ITW employee handbook and established performance accountability processes by consistently addressing and documenting unacceptable behaviors, poor performance, and attendance issues. Leverage the Manufacturing and/or Plant Manager for support and direction, as needed.
  • Effectively lead and manage the performance and development of direct reports by managing employee relations, complete annual performance evaluations, interview prospective hires, and lead onboarding and training initiatives
  • Maintain attendance records daily to ensure smooth payroll processing for the specified time interval
  • Develop plans for coverage with cell leaders
  • Report absent employees to the appropriate Manufacturing personnel and assist in restructuring available resources to maximize machine uptime
  • Onboard new team members by:
    • Utilizing work instructions, training presentations, and on-the-job training
    • Identifying team members to help develop their skills during the initial training period determined by you
    • Conducting 30/60/90 day reviews at each specified interval using the established checklist
  • Ensure safe working conditions, rules and practices are followed, and work with Cell personnel to ensure 5S activities are implemented and are being completed
  • Develop team members by identifying and promoting training and other improvement activities
  • Troubleshoot/monitor manufacturing bottlenecks
  • Communicate shift reports via email, crossover meetings, and/or text to the appropriate Senior Leadership, Manufacturing, Quality, Customer Relations, and Reliability personnel
  • Conduct ongoing communication with General Techs through Gemba walks and daily shift crossover meetings
  • Ensure containment and traceability of non-conforming product is completed or communicated to the next shift
  • Manage the inventory status of approved and non-conforming product utilizing the ERP system
  • Participate in root cause analysis activities for factors affecting overall product quality
  • Identify continuous improvement opportunities
  • Collect and report Manufacturing metrics as assigned and continuously work to create and execute improvement plans
  • Responsible for part quality associated with set up and processing parameters
  • Use personal computer, dial/digital calipers, gauges, hand tools, hand/power lift trucks, and overhead cranes
  • Other tasks and duties as assigned

Position Skills and Experience Requirements:

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Experience Leading and Holding Team Members accountable is a must.
  • Willing to hold themselves and others accountable for the roles and duties that have been assigned to them
  • Computer skills, including Microsoft Office, is a plus
  • Learn about the job duties of a General Technician, Material Handler, and/or Mold Technician
  • Technical experience with plastic injection molding preferred, along with hands-on experience with raw materials, mold set-up, and troubleshooting skills for material central feed systems
  • Qualified candidate will possess a good work ethic, is reliable, and dedicated to quality. Must be capable of working in a fast-paced environment.
  • Able to lift 55 lbs
  • Excellent communication skills both written and verbal (English), good visual skills, and reasoning ability
  • Team player who demonstrates the ability to relate to employees at all levels of the organization
